Building Bridges Navigating Cliques and Cultivating Positive Connections
by GARCIA SOPHIE

Building Bridges Navigating Cliques and Cultivating Positive Connections is a practical and insightful guide for anyone seeking to navigate the complex dynamics of social groups and build meaningful, supportive relationships. In today’s world, cliques can often feel like barriers to inclusion, leaving individuals feeling isolated, misunderstood, or left out. This book takes readers on a journey to understand the impact of cliques, while offering strategies to break down social barriers and foster genuine, positive connections.
At the heart of Building Bridges is the belief that social dynamics don’t have to be divisive. The book encourages readers to explore how cliques form, what they represent, and how they can unintentionally promote exclusion. By recognizing the underlying causes of cliques, readers gain the tools to transform social situations, promote inclusivity, and create environments where everyone feels valued.
Through a mix of real-world examples, insightful advice, and proven techniques, Building Bridges offers a roadmap for navigating social landscapes with confidence and empathy. It emphasizes the importance of emotional intelligence, active listening, and building trust—essential elements for cultivating authentic connections. Readers learn how to embrace diversity, overcome misunderstandings, and create spaces where mutual respect and kindness flourish, ultimately transforming negative or exclusive environments into welcoming communities.
The book also addresses how to identify toxic dynamics within groups and offers concrete steps to break free from unproductive or harmful social circles. Whether it's at school, work, or in other social settings, Building Bridges helps individuals strengthen their interpersonal skills and build connections that are based on shared interests, respect, and support. It also encourages readers to be proactive in cultivating a sense of belonging by extending kindness and understanding to others, no matter their background or social status.
In Building Bridges, readers will discover the power of positive connections and the ways in which they can shift their social landscape, moving from isolation and division to unity and collaboration. By mastering the art of navigating cliques, this book empowers readers to build relationships that are meaningful, enriching, and lasting—fostering a sense of community and belonging for everyone involved.
